Embark on a journey through radiant musical waters with Yacht Rock Revue, the band Rolling Stone hails as the “world’s premier soft-rock party band.” Their repertoire, spanning from the sun-kissed melodies of Steely Dan and Michael McDonald to the velvety harmonies of Hall & Oates, evokes memories of palm trees, ocean breezes, and carefree summers. The group continues to transport audiences back to the golden era of the ’70s and ’80s while charting bold new horizons in the present day.
Founded in Atlanta, GA, Yacht Rock Revue features Nicholas Niespodziani (vocals, guitars, keyboards, percussion), Peter Olson (vocals, guitars, keyboards, percussion), Greg Lee (bass, vocals), Mark Dannells (guitars, vocals), Mark Bencuya (keyboards, vocals), David B. Freeman (saxophones, keyboards, flute, piccolo, percussion, vocals), Kourtney Jackson (vocals, percussion), Jason Nackers (drums), and Ganesh Giri Jaya (drums). Their collective musicianship elevates each performance into an immersive, joy-filled escape.
Released in late 2024, their original concept album, Escape Artist, marked a major milestone for the band as their first release of original music since Hot Dads In Tight Jeans. After an unforgettable 2023 run with Kenny Loggins and a 2024 touring season that included a 44-city Summer Road Trip Tour with Train and REO Speedwagon, Yacht Rock Revue continues to build momentum in 2025 with a run of sold-out shows, including The Paramount in Huntington (two nights), Ryman Auditorium, Humphrey’s in San Diego (two nights), Pier 17 in New York, Wolf Trap, Leader Bank Pavilion in Boston (two nights), and the Salt Shed in Chicago. Their live shows remain unabashedly joyous affairs, praised by The New York Times for their liberating energy and by Entertainment Weekly for their ability to turn any venue into a sea of dancing fans.
From humble beginnings in a basement in 2007 to sharing stages with legends like Robbie Dupree, Elliot Lurie, Matthew Wilder, John Oates, and the late Eddie Money, Yacht Rock Revue has transformed what was once considered a guilty pleasure into a thriving, respected art form.
At the heart of Yacht Rock Revue’s success is their devoted fanbase, the “Anchorheads”—a vibrant community celebrating music, nostalgia, and connection. Niespodziani describes them as “wonderful people, musical omnivores and exactly the kind of fans you dream about having as a young musician.”
